About 3 Davies Close
3 Davies Close is a four-bedroom detached house in Kettering (NN15 7RE). It has a recorded floor area of 159 m² (around 1711 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1996-2002 and council tax band E. The latest certificate (February 2017) shows a C (score 69), just inside the C band.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 81).
On energy efficiency it sits in the top 10% of properties in this postcode. 9 years since the last transfer (July 2017). Across the public record there are 4 sales, relatively high churn for a single property. One planning record on file: a garage conversion approved in 2011. Past consents include a garage conversion,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Across 1998–2017, sale prices on this property compounded at 6%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£465,000 is 27.4% above the 2017 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£213/sq ft) was about 49.1% above the typical sold price in the postcode.
